Cambiare permessi in modo ricorsivo

Installazione, configurazione e uso di programmi e strumenti.
array81
Prode Principiante
Messaggi: 6
Iscrizione: domenica 21 ottobre 2007, 13:43

Cambiare permessi in modo ricorsivo

Messaggio da array81 »

Recentemente sono passato da Kubuntu a Ubuntu. Mi trovo molto meglio, con grande sorpresa con Gnome mi trovo molto meglio che con KDE.
Il problema è Nautilus: su Kubuntu avevo installato LAMPP e Joomla senza problemi e tutto funzionava per il meglio.
Ora invece su Ubunto ho problemi penso legati hai permessi, la cartella contenente i files di Joomla ha impostati i permessi 777 (sudo chmod 777) quindi pensavo che tutto quello che ci mettevo assumesse tali permessi ma a quanto pare mi sbaglio infatti files e cartelle hanno permessi diversi e quando ad esempio provo ad installare qualche componente o ad usarne qualcuno ricevo di continuo errori penso legati ai permessi.

Qualcuno mi sa dire per favore come posso risolvere questo problema, faccio presente che la nella mia home di utente ho creato una cartella www all'interno della quale c'è la cartella Joomla linkkata con la cartella /opt/lampp/htdocs/ di LAMPP.

Ho pensato che dando il massimo dei permessi a tutto ciò che è contenuto nella cartella Joomla la cosa si potrebbe risolvere ma non riesco a capire come assegnare il massimo dei permessi a tutte le cartelle e i files in modo ricorsivo con Nautilus. IN alternativa c'è un qualche tools grafico per farlo.

Ho incominciato da poco a usare Linux quindi vi prego di essere dettagliati nelle spiegazioni.

Grazie.
Avatar utente
Adaron
Scoppiettante Seguace
Scoppiettante Seguace
Messaggi: 982
Iscrizione: giovedì 12 ottobre 2006, 23:53
Località: Savona

Re: Cambiare permessi in modo ricorsivo

Messaggio da Adaron »

lo puoi fare in due modi:
nel primo modo fai click col destro sulla cartella radice di joomla, setti tutti i permessi in lettura e scrittura e poi clicchi il pulsante "APPLICA I PERMESSI AI FILE CONTENUTI"
nel secondo modo invece apri una shell e dai questo comando:
sudo chmod -R 777 /home/tu_user/path/joomla
e dopo averti chiesto la pass, aggiorna la cartella di joomla e tutti i files in essa contenuti (radice compresa) dovrebbe avere i permessi da te scelti.
[center]Io sono in te, tu sei in Me. Noi siamo Uno
io sono in te, tu sei in me. Noi siamo Uno.
Tu sei in me, io sono in Te. Noi siamo Uno.
Avatar utente
Guiodic
Accecante Asceta
Accecante Asceta
Messaggi: 28474
Iscrizione: martedì 24 aprile 2007, 15:28
Località: Roma
Contatti:

Re: Cambiare permessi in modo ricorsivo

Messaggio da Guiodic »

Adaron ha scritto:
sudo chmod -R 777 /home/tu_user/path/joomla
Difatti -R è proprio l'opzione per la ricorsione.
array81
Prode Principiante
Messaggi: 6
Iscrizione: domenica 21 ottobre 2007, 13:43

Re: Cambiare permessi in modo ricorsivo

Messaggio da array81 »

Se clikko di destro e poi vado su propietà non mi fa cambiare permessi (i pulsanti sono grigi), quindi quello che vacevo era di aprire la cartella www come amministratore attraverso un script installato su Nautilus quindi cambiare di permessi attraverso il comando "APPLICA I PERMESSI AI FILE CONTENUTI" ma di fatto non riuscivo a cambiarli nel senso che quando riprovavo ad usare Joomla ottenevo sempre errori del tipo "Joomla non può scrivere dentro la cartella xxx" e robba del genere.

Ora non ho ubuntu sotto mano, questa sera proverò da riga di comado, volevo evitarlo dato che provenendo da Windows mi risulta molto più semplice l'interfaccia grafica. Il problema è che con Dolphin (KDE) non avevo problemi invece con Nautilus per quanto mi piaccia molto di più con i permessi proprio non mi riesce di utilizzarlo.

Questa sera vi aggiorno.
Scrivi risposta

Ritorna a “Applicazioni”

Chi c’è in linea

Visualizzano questa sezione: 0 utenti iscritti e 14 ospiti